reverse_debugging no longer depends on Avocado, so remove the import checks for Avocado, the per-arch endianness tweaks, and the per-arch register settings. All of these are now handled in the ReverseDebugging class, automatically. Reviewed-by: Thomas Huth <thuth@redhat.com> Reviewed-by: Daniel P.
